About the Role

The role involves preparing written reports and presentations, compiling project progress data, and acting as the primary technical lead for field engineering issues related to reinforced concrete foundations, structural steel, bollard walls, poles, towers, temporary structures, and in‑water or floodplain construction. The engineer will collaborate with contractors, design firms, Parsons staff, and subject‑matter experts to investigate challenges, develop scope of work, estimate impacts, review contractor submittals, respond to RFIs, and participate in construction meetings and quality‑control inspections. • Prepare written reports, presentations, and compile project progress data. • Lead technical and engineering efforts for reinforced concrete foundations, structural steel, bollard walls, poles, towers, temporary structures, and floodplain/in‑water construction. • Collaborate with contractors, design firms, Parsons staff, and SMEs to resolve field engineering challenges. • Develop scope of work, estimate cost and schedule impacts, and review contractor submittals and RFIs. • Participate in pre‑construction, quality‑control, progress, and other construction meetings. • Conduct technical compliance inspections and provide recommendations on construction techniques and quality‑control plans.

What You Bring

Parsons is seeking an experienced Senior Structural Engineer to serve as the Sector Construction Management Office Engineer and technical lead for construction sites, supporting the assigned Construction Manager. The position can be based in San Diego, CA; El Paso, TX; or Edinburg, TX, and will provide Owner Agent Construction Management Services such as program management, risk management, scheduling, cost estimating, progress reporting, quality assurance, and safety. Candidates must hold a Bachelor’s degree in Structural or Civil Engineering with a structural emphasis, have at least ten years of construction‑management experience, be U.S. citizens eligible for federal background checks, and possess a valid driver’s license. Strong written and verbal communication, civil technical judgment, and experience with large infrastructure projects, web‑based project‑management systems, design‑build contracts, and technical specifications are required. Preferred qualifications include PMP or CCM certification, PE registration, prior work with large federal agencies, experience on remote‑site projects, recent completion of a Construction Quality Management course, and OSHA 30‑hour safety training. The position does not require a security clearance and operates within Parsons’ Federal Solutions segment, which provides services to U.S. government customers in defense, security, intelligence, infrastructure, and environmental domains. • Hold a Bachelor’s degree in Structural or Civil Engineering with a structural emphasis. • Possess at least 10 years of construction‑management experience on large infrastructure projects. • Demonstrate strong written and verbal communication and solid civil technical judgment. • Experience with web‑based project‑management systems (e.g., Procore, USACE RMS) and design‑build contracts. • Preferred: PMP or CCM certification, PE registration, federal agency experience, recent Construction Quality Management or OSHA 30‑hour training.
